What’s Included in a Costa Rica Surf Camp Package?

Witch's Rock - Costa Rica Surf Camp • February 23, 2026

If you’re planning a surf trip to Costa Rica, you’ve probably come across the term “surf camp package.” But what does a surf camp package actually include?

Most Costa Rica surf camp packages combine accommodations, surf coaching, surfboards, and transportation into one organized experience designed to simplify your trip and maximize time in the water.

Instead of booking hotels, surf lessons, equipment rentals, and transportation separately, surf camps provide a structured surf travel experience for beginners, intermediate surfers, and advanced surfers alike.

Beachfront Accommodations

One of the biggest advantages of a surf camp package is staying close to the waves.

Many surf camps are located within walking distance of the beach, allowing surfers to maximize time in the water and spend less time dealing with transportation and logistics.

At Witch’s Rock Surf Camp , guests stay just steps from Tamarindo Beach, one of the most consistent surf spots in Costa Rica.

Being close to the ocean allows surfers to:

  • catch early morning waves
  • surf again in the afternoon
  • easily join daily lessons and coaching sessions
  • experience the local surf culture

Daily Surf Lessons or Guided Surf Tours

Surf instruction is the foundation of most surf camp packages.

Depending on your surf level, programs typically include structured lessons, coaching sessions, or guided surf tours.

Beginner Surf Lessons

Beginner programs usually focus on:

  • learning the pop-up
  • understanding wave timing
  • ocean safety
  • surf etiquette

Intermediate Surf Coaching

Intermediate surfers typically focus on improving positioning, timing, wave selection, and overall technique.

Many surf camps include video analysis and coaching sessions designed to accelerate progression.

Advanced Surf Tours

Advanced surfers often join guided surf trips to more powerful waves and surf breaks based on swell, tide, and wind conditions.

Our advanced surfers frequently visit breaks such as Witch’s Rock, Ollie’s Point, Playa Grande, and Avellanas.

Surfboards and Equipment

Most surf camps provide access to multiple surfboards so guests can experiment with different shapes and sizes throughout their trip.

Typical board options may include:

  • beginner soft-top boards
  • longboards
  • funboards
  • performance shortboards

Having access to multiple boards allows surfers to adapt to changing conditions and progress faster during the week.

Surf Coaching, Video Analysis & Seminars

Modern surf camps often include coaching sessions specifically designed to accelerate surf progression.

These sessions may cover topics such as:

  • reading waves
  • positioning in the lineup
  • improving takeoffs
  • refining turns
  • understanding surf conditions

Video analysis can be especially valuable because surfers are able to review their technique and make practical adjustments much faster.

Breakfast and Meals

Some surf camps are fully all-inclusive, while others include daily breakfast as part of the package.

At Witch’s Rock Surf Camp , guests enjoy daily breakfast at our beachfront restaurant before heading out for surf sessions and coaching.

Airport Transportation

Many surf camps simplify travel logistics by including airport transportation directly to the surf destination.

For Tamarindo surf camps, guests typically fly into Liberia International Airport (LIR) .

Transportation is then arranged directly to the surf camp, helping travelers avoid complicated travel planning after arrival.

What Is NOT Included in Most Surf Camps

While surf camps provide a convenient all-in-one experience, not every service is always included in the base price.

Some surf camps may charge extra for:

  • lunch and dinner meals
  • alcoholic beverages
  • optional boat trips to advanced surf breaks
  • travel insurance
  • international flights to Costa Rica

Understanding what is and is not included helps travelers compare surf camp packages more accurately.

Why Tamarindo Works So Well for Surf Camps

Tamarindo has become one of the most popular surf camp destinations in Costa Rica because it offers:

  • consistent waves year-round
  • warm water temperatures
  • beginner-friendly beach breaks
  • nearby advanced surf spots

This combination makes Tamarindo ideal for surfers of all levels.

FAQ

What does a surf camp package include?

Most surf camp packages include accommodations, surf lessons or coaching, access to surfboards, and organized surf sessions. Some packages also include meals and airport transportation.

Are surf camp packages good for beginners?

Yes. Many surf camps are specifically designed for beginners and provide structured lessons that teach the fundamentals of surfing and ocean safety.

What airport do you fly into for Tamarindo surf camps?

Most surfers fly into Liberia International Airport (LIR) , which is about one hour from Tamarindo.

Do surf camps provide surfboards?

Yes. Most surf camps include access to multiple surfboards so guests can choose the right board for their skill level and conditions.

Yes — Tamarindo is considered one of the safest beach towns in Costa Rica for tourists. Most incidents involve petty theft, while violent crime affecting visitors is rare. With basic precautions, it’s a very safe destination for surfers, families, and solo travelers. Costa Rica has long been known as one of the most stable, welcoming countries in Latin America. Yet online discussions, headlines, and occasional embassy alerts often raise the same question for travelers: Is Costa Rica safe — and is Tamarindo safe to visit? This guide separates facts from perception , explains why safety concerns are often misunderstood , and looks specifically at Tamarindo through the lens that actually matters: the real experience of travelers on the ground . At Witch’s Rock Surf Camp, we’ve hosted thousands of travelers, families, and solo surfers in Tamarindo since 2001 — giving us a real, on-the-ground perspective of what safety actually looks like here. Understanding Safety the Right Way: Tourist Reality vs Headlines When people search “Is Costa Rica safe?”, they are often shown national crime statistics without context. This creates confusion. Here’s the key point: 👉 Tourist safety is not measured by national crime averages — it’s measured by what happens in tourist areas. National crime data includes: Drug-trafficking activity Gang-related violence Urban neighborhoods far from tourism Domestic and local disputes unrelated to visitors These factors do not reflect the reality of beach towns, surf destinations, or established tourist communities like Tamarindo. The same logic applies everywhere: Crime in parts of Los Angeles does not define safety in Malibu Crime in New York City does not define safety in the Hamptons Crime in Mexico City does not define safety in Cozumel Tamarindo must be evaluated as a tourist destination — not as a national statistic.
